cobaltTangerine Posted December 13, 2021 Share Posted December 13, 2021 (edited) I'm about 30 hours into the game. Fun game, but as I was knocking off a number of side quests last night, I was looking at a lot of load screens. I realized I'd just finished 100 quests and decided to do the math. How long have I been looking at load screens so far? Each mission will involve anywhere between 3-10+ load screens. These will likely either involve fast travel or entering/exiting buildings and new areas. As a conservative estimate, let's say I'm averaging 5 load screens per mission. Each load screen (PS4) is between 15-30 seconds. As another conservative estimate, 20 seconds per load screen. That is 100 seconds of load screens per mission. During 100 missions, you get 10,000 seconds of load screens, which is 166 minutes of load screens, equaling almost 3 hours. 3 hours. That is the ultimate challenge of this Platinum, not the game itself, but knowing, if I go through with this one, there are easily another 3+ hours of load screens in my future. leon1511 Posted December 16, 2021 Share Posted December 16, 2021 Hey I posted this on gamefaqs and this is about the loading times between the 3 and 4 and this is what I came up with Well I just timed both the PS4 and PS3 versions and the 3 loading times for me was half the time for the 4. I did in and out times going in and out of Gorhart Inn. The times on the 4 were 18 secs in and 44 out and on the 2nd run it was the same, while the 3 version was 10 sec in and 20-22 sec out. I started with the 4 first and then the 3. The 4 version also is darker on my tv then what the 3 version is. When I loaded up the 3 version the colors in the first dungeon were vibrant and colorful while the 4 version was really dark and it was hard for me to see around me. So I'll just stick with the 3.
